The first time ever I saw your face

The first time ever I saw your face,
The world stood still in soft embrace.

The sky grew wide, the stars burned bright,

As if they'd known love’s birth that night.

Ā 

Your eyes, like oceans deep and true,

Reflected dreams I never knew.

A single glance, a fleeting touch,

Yet in that moment—felt so much.

Ā 

The air was hushed, the earth stood near,

As if to listen, just to hear—

The silent words our souls would weave,

A love so pure, so hard to leave.

Ā 

The first time ever I held your hand,

The universe could understand—

That time itself had lost its place,

The first time ever I saw your face.
